Saudi Arabia's Diplomatic Shift: Host to Trump Talks on Ukraine

The selection of Saudi Arabia for crucial discussions reflects the Kingdom's evolving role in global diplomacy, moving beyond its contentious recent past.
The recent decision by the Trump administration to host significant talks on the Ukraine conflict in Saudi Arabia marks a notable shift in the Kingdom's diplomatic stature.

Once viewed as a pariah state following the 2018 murder of journalist Jamal Khashoggi, Saudi Arabia has since endeavored to restore its international standing.

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man has faced ongoing scrutiny regarding the nation's human rights record; however, the Kingdom has made substantial strides in various sectors, particularly in entertainment and sports, as part of its broader strategy to enhance its global presence.

This investment demonstrates Saudi Arabia's desire to reshape its image on the world stage.

Under the Biden administration, Saudi Arabia has indicated a strategic pivot away from its historical reliance on the United States.

This realignment has involved forging closer ties with nations often perceived as adversaries of U.S. interests, including Russia and China.

The potential return of Donald Trump to the White House is anticipated to resonate positively with Saudi leadership, given his previous administration's transactional approach to foreign policy.

During his tenure, Trump's inaugural foreign visit was to Saudi Arabia, a gesture that underscored the importance of the bilateral relationship.

An endeavor the former President may prioritize is facilitating a peace agreement between Saudi Arabia and Israel, which would extend the Abraham Accords initiated during his first term.

Current regional dynamics, particularly the ongoing conflict in Gaza, pose challenges to these ambitions.

Following Trump's controversial proposal to evacuate Palestinians from Gaza for reconstruction, Saudi Arabia promptly rejected the plan, demonstrating its commitment to negotiating a solution that would prioritize the well-being of Gazans.

In response, the Kingdom is collaborating with other Arab states to formulate a viable alternative aimed at achieving a two-state solution between Israel and Palestine.

As the Trump administration's policies appear increasingly misaligned with Saudi objectives regarding Gaza and the occupied West Bank, these developments will play a pivotal role in shaping the future of U.S.-Saudi relations.

Nevertheless, Saudi Arabia remains resolute in its ambitions to establish itself as a key player in global diplomacy.
